Social factors that can increase the risk of emotional distress include: Bullying. Difficult relationships with friends or partners. Being overwhelmed with studies or work. Financial worries. Alcohol or drug misuse. Having a friend or a family member that self-harms. Traumatic experiences. Being abused (sexually, emotionally or physically). The death of a friend or a family member. Having a miscarriage.
